In the below two photos, we are not certain who they are but believe they are of the Grogard family. They were taken in Wisconsin where Halvor Grogard lived at one time. He was married twice, first to Aase Sandersdatter and then to Agot Levorsdatter. These photos were with my grandmother's things. She is a daughter of Halvor, who lived in Traill County, east of Buxton. He had several sons and four daughters, Louisa who married Peter Odegard, Guri who married Johannes Odegard, Jorgine who married John Lerom, and Helen who married Iver Gruah. In the picture below, one person remains a mystery. The event is the wedding of Martinus and Emma (Indergaard) Aaker. They were married at the Charles Anton Digness farm near Hatton, Traill County, North Dakota in 1881. Pictured left to right are - Unknown man, Martinus Indergaard, Anna (Koldingness) Aaker, Gustav Aaker, Emma (Aaker) Indergaard and Clara (Aaker) Tveten.
